Dive into advanced network security concepts in this comprehensive 3-hour video course. Master essential cybersecurity principles crucial for certifications like CompTIA Security+, SSCP, Cisco CCNA Security/Cyberops, and Certified Ethical Hacker (CEH). Explore VPNs, PKI, and Cisco security through detailed lessons covering on-premises and cloud threats, security vulnerabilities, cryptographic services, site-to-site and remote access VPNs, security intelligence, endpoint protection, SDN concepts, network programmability, and automation. Learn to leverage Cisco platforms, APIs, and Python scripts for enhanced network security. Gain hands-on experience with practical examples and prepare for a successful career in IT security.
